Types of Kitchen Bar Tables and Stools Sets
With a vast array of styles, materials, and configurations available, finding the perfect kitchen bar table and stools set to match your unique taste and needs can be overwhelming. Here are some popular options to consider:
- Counter-Height Tables**: Ideal for food preparation and casual dining, these tables typically stand between 34-36 inches tall.
- Pub-Style Tables**: Raised to 42 inches or higher, these tables create a clear distinction between the kitchen and living areas.
- Island-Style Tables**: Combining a table with storage and countertop space, these units offer maximum functionality and flexibility.
Essential Considerations for Your Kitchen Bar Table and Stools Set
Before making a purchase, take the following factors into account to ensure your new kitchen addition is a perfect fit:
- Space Constraints**: Measure your kitchen carefully to determine the ideal size and shape of your bar table and stools.
- Material and Finish**: Choose durable, easy-to-clean materials that complement your kitchen's style and aesthetic.
- Seating Capacity**: Consider the number of stools you need, as well as their style, material, and comfort level.
